As I mentioned in one of the other Navi threads floating about, her biggest problem is how often she is set to remind you about the next dungeon in your quest. Every new area, and every house you walk into, Navi will wait anything from 30 seconds to a minute, before once again reminding you about the quest you should be on.

Her reminding you isn't a problem. Her doing so with such frequency, however, is. Especially with so many side-quests ripe for the adventurin', with the constant reminder preventing you from going into first-person view (something I often found irritating while on secret hunts).

If that had been toned down some, then she would have been far more tolerable, and she probably wouldn't have gained so much hate. But "Hey! Hey! Hey!" every minute or so when you're crossing Hyrule field for any reason does grate, especially if you're playing the game for a few hours.

I don't really Take sides in this debate. I don't like or dislike her, but she wasn't annoying. Things i didn't like about her include:
- between dungeons, if you are doing sidequests,getting epona, or whatever else, she bothers you every 45 or so seconds saying "Didn't Darunia say something about the Water Temple? Hurry! let's go to Zora's Domain!"
- She repeats the same message EVERY. SINGLE. TIME
- She tells you things that are extremely obvious: "Press A to open the door"... Seriously....

That's something they improved on with Tatl, she didn't bother you every 45 seconds, and she only told you tp go to the next dungeon when you played the song of time. But She didn't give ANY useful information about enemies: "Seriously, if you don't know about Skullatulas, you have a real problem" and stuff along the lines of that.

Things i LIKE about Navi:
- She ACTUALLY gave info on the enemies, that was sometimes pretty useful
- she had the first Voice acting in any zelda game (which is still uncommon today, i think the only other voice acting was link saying 'come here' in Wind Waker)

So yeah, the pros and cons are about even with her, and she was improved upon in the Form of Tatl in MM anyway, so no reason to complain really :/
